Singapore Bank Q1 2024 Performance: A Mixed Bag of Margins, Wealth, and Trade
Singapore's banking sector reported a mixed bag of results for the first quarter of 2024, with a complex interplay of rising interest rates, robust wealth management performance, and a surprisingly strong trade finance sector. While net interest margins (NIMs) showed a somewhat subdued performance for some institutions, the overall picture is painted with strokes of both resilience and opportunity.
Net Interest Margins: A Tale of Two Halves
The impact of rising interest rates, a global trend throughout 2023, continues to be felt in Singapore. While increased rates generally boost NIMs – the difference between the interest a bank earns on loans and the interest it pays on deposits – the Q1 2024 results revealed a nuanced story. Some major banks experienced a slight compression in NIMs, attributed to increased competition and the cost of attracting deposits in a higher-rate environment. This suggests that while the opportunity exists for increased profitability, the competitive landscape is preventing a full realization of this potential. Analysts suggest a watchful wait to see if this trend continues throughout the year.
Wealth Management: A Bright Spot in a Challenging Market
Despite global economic uncertainty, Singapore's wealth management sector thrived in Q1 2024. Several banks reported booming revenue in this sector, fueled by strong client activity and increased inflows of assets under management (AUM). This positive performance highlights Singapore's continued attractiveness as a premier wealth management hub in Asia. The robust performance in wealth management served as a crucial buffer against the slightly underwhelming NIMs, contributing significantly to overall profitability. Experts anticipate continued growth in this sector, driven by both regional and global high-net-worth individuals seeking sophisticated financial solutions.
Trade Finance: Unexpected Strength Amidst Global Headwinds
One of the most surprising elements of the Q1 2024 reports was the unexpectedly strong performance of trade finance. Despite global economic slowdown concerns and geopolitical instability, several banks reported significant growth in this area. This indicates that Singapore's strategic position as a major global trade hub continues to be a significant driver of revenue and underscores the resilience of the city-state's economy. This sector's performance offers a reassuring counterpoint to the more cautious outlook on NIMs.
